We are doing a short run project for a company. We are a stamping factory. They want to stamp out a flat "V" shaped retention spring out of 0.018" thick steel and measure 0.010" flatness,
unrestrained. I usually deal with material that is thicker than this. Anyone have any ideas?
depending on how big this is, i would build a fixture that has three points (one mounting point at each end and one in the middle where the bend is, apply some glue to the underside where the 3 points contact the part and measure the flatness.
